1984 Ferrari Testarossa vs. 1995 Nissan 300 ZX

To start off, 1995 Nissan 300 ZX is newer by 11 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Ferrari Testarossa.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Ferrari Testarossa would be higher. At 4,942 cc (12 cylinders), 1984 Ferrari Testarossa is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1984 Ferrari Testarossa (386 HP @ 6300 RPM) has 107 more horse power than 1995 Nissan 300 ZX. (279 HP @ 6400 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1984 Ferrari Testarossa should accelerate faster than 1995 Nissan 300 ZX.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1995 Nissan 300 ZX weights approximately 79 kg more than 1984 Ferrari Testarossa.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1984 Ferrari Testarossa (490 Nm @ 4500 RPM) has 114 more torque (in Nm) than 1995 Nissan 300 ZX. (376 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 1984 Ferrari Testarossa will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1995 Nissan 300 ZX.

Compare all specifications:

1984 Ferrari Testarossa 1995 Nissan 300 ZX
Make Ferrari Nissan
Model Testarossa 300 ZX
Year Released 1984 1995
Body Type Coupe Coupe
Engine Position Middle Front
Engine Size 4942 cc 2960 cc
Engine Cylinders 12 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type V V
Valves per Cylinder 4 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 386 HP 279 HP
Engine RPM 6300 RPM 6400 RPM
Torque 490 Nm 376 Nm
Torque RPM 4500 RPM 3600 RPM
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 2 seats 2 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 1506 kg 1585 kg
Vehicle Length 4490 mm 4530 mm
Vehicle Width 1980 mm 1810 mm
Vehicle Height 1140 mm 1260 mm
Wheelbase Size 2460 mm 2580 mm
